This recipe was extracted from The white ribbon cook book (1894) by Kathryn Armstrong, page 88.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.

Strawberry Saracen— Toast very thin slices of stale bread and line the bottom and sides of a China dish with them, after buttering gener- ously. Trim the bread to fit the dish neatly. Fill the space with strawberries packed and heaped as full as the dish will hold; sift plenty of sugar all through and over them
